On Mon, May 2, 2016 at 7:36 AM, <chengang@emindsoft.com.cn> wrote:
> From: Chen Gang <chengang@emindsoft.com.cn>
>
> According to kasan_[dis|en]able_current() comments and the kasan_depth'
> s initialization, if kasan_depth is zero, it means disable.
The comments for those functions are really poor, but there's nothing
there that says kasan_depth==0 disables KASAN.
Actually, kasan_report_enabled() is currently the only place that
denotes the semantics of kasan_depth, so it couldn't be wrong.
init_task.kasan_depth is 1 during bootstrap and is then set to zero by
kasan_init()
For every other thread, current->kasan_depth is zero-initialized.
> So need use "!!kasan_depth" instead of "!kasan_depth" for checking
> enable.
